#822808 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#822808 is composed of 51% red, 15.7%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.2% magenta, 93.8%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 15.7 degrees, a saturation of 88.4% and a lightness of 27.1%. #822808 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5010 with #050000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

Shades and Tints of #822808

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fef2ed is the lightest one.
